§ 17-324. Cooperation with other jurisdictions
(a) The Administrator may enter into agreements with other states to exchange information needed to enable this or another state to audit or otherwise determine unclaimed property that it or another state may be entitled to subject to a claim of custody. The Administrator by rule may require the reporting of information needed to enable compliance with agreements made pursuant to this section and prescribe the form.
(b) To avoid conflicts between the Administrator's procedures and the procedures of administrators in other jurisdictions that enact the Uniform Unclaimed Property Act, the Administrator, so far as is consistent with the purposes, policies, and provisions of this subtitle, before adopting, amending, or repealing rules, may advise and consult with administrators in other jurisdictions that enact substantially the Uniform Unclaimed Property Act and take into consideration the rules of administrators in other jurisdictions that enact the Uniform Unclaimed Property Act.
Credits
Added by Acts 1985, c. 602, § 1, eff. July 1, 1985. Amended by Acts 1986, c. 5, § 1.
